Preparation method of rooting agent for promoting winter sweet cutting
A rooting agent and cutting technology are applied in the field of promoting the preparation of a rooting agent for cuttings of Lamei, can solve the problems of no bacteriostatic, anti-inflammatory and antiseptic effect, easy infection of cut incisions of Lamei, easy photolysis of indole acetic acid, etc., and achieve enhanced water absorption and transportation. Function, prevent incision infection and bacterial decay, and improve the effect of cutting survival rate

Embodiment 2
[0017] 1) Preparation of ferrous chelating agent: Weigh 10 parts of active polypeptide and completely dissolve in 91 parts of distilled water, add 10 parts of FeCl with a mass fraction of 10% under stirring 2 Aqueous solution, adjust the pH to 6.3, shake and synthesize at 38°C for 24 minutes, dry and pulverize in vacuum to obtain the active polypeptide ferrous chelating agent, during the preparation process, the active polypeptide and FeCl 2 The mass ratio is 10:1; the process of preparing ferrous chelating agent is simple and easy to control, suitable for industrial production, active polypeptide and FeCI 2 When the mass ratio of the chelate was 10:1, the chelation degree of the chelate was the highest;

Embodiment 3
[0021] Preparation of ferrous chelating agent: Weigh 10 parts of active peptides and dissolve them completely in 90 parts of distilled water, add 10 parts of FeCl with a mass fraction of 10% under stirring 2 Aqueous solution, adjust the pH to 6.1, shake and synthesize at 37°C for 20 minutes, dry and pulverize in vacuum to obtain the active polypeptide ferrous chelating agent, during the preparation process, the active polypeptide and FeCl 2 The mass ratio is 10:1; the process of preparing ferrous chelating agent is simple and easy to control, suitable for industrial production, active polypeptide and FeCI 2 When the mass ratio of the chelating compound is 10:1, the chelating degree of the chelate is the highest, and the active polypeptide ferrous chelating agent has a strong anti-photooxidation effect, and is prepared for the compounding of the auxin solution;
